    This is my first post. I have worked for 15 years in the courier business with the same 2000 Tacoma. It now has 905,673 miles on it with the original engine, trans and differential. It still gets 25 mpg and passed its last smog test with no problem. My friends say I should let people know about it. There is a rumor that Toyota may give me a new one if I hit a million miles. I would appreciate anyone who knows how to actually pull that off.
